India Blocks China At WTO

ABU DHABI (ANI) – India on February 28 blocked the China-led Investment Facilitation Development Agreement (IFD) in the World Trade Organization (WTO), so the proposal is unlikely to be mentioned in the outcome document of the ministerial conference. South Africa also joined India in the blocking.

The 123-member group led by China tried to forward a proposal in the working group meeting on development.

Official sources said the IFD is an agreement among the Belt and Road Initiative countries and is led by vested interests.

The IFD initiative aims to develop a global agreement to improve the investment and business climate and make it easier for investors in all sectors of the economy to invest, conduct their day-to-day business, and expand their operations.

India says it is a non trade issue.
